Thinking Ahead & Planning Christmas.  If you’ve been to most any shop in town, you will find that they are all beginning to be loaded with Christmas.  If you want to add something new to your Christmas, you have to look now or it will probably be gone by the time Christmas rolls around.  I always like to look back at a few past Christmas decorations to get inspired for this year.  Sometimes I do a similar repeat, and other times I mix different ideas together or start from scratch and create something totally different.

Looking at the past – here are a few pictures from past Christmases.

2021 Christmas Home Tour.

I didn’t use a lot of color this year.  I went with cream, chocolate and copper.   I used the smaller flocked tree instead of the green one.

2020 Christmas Home Tour. 

This was a hard year for me.  Jim had just passed away a few months earlier, so I poured all my energy into loading the tree with all the ornaments.  My younger son helped me set up the 9′ tree and I just hung every ornament I had on it.

2019 Christmas Home Tour

Cream, rust, and copper were the main colors this year.  I kept most of the color neutral.

2018 Christmas Home Tour

 

Jim loved Christmas, so he wanted a taller tree since we have two-story ceilings in the living room.  We got this 9 ft. one and he still placed it on a small box to make it even taller.  Rust Satin and Rust Plaid ribbon and plaid pillows were prominent this year.

 

2017 Christmas Home Tour

This was our first year in this house and we were still in the middle of remodels.   Green, silver and gold were my colors.

Not sure what color I want to use this year.  I do like the flocked tree.  It’s smaller and easier for me to put up and it shows off the ornaments better, so I think I’ll use that again.  Now to visit all the stores and see what catches my eye.  Do you like to plan out your Christmas too?
